Just when Bluebell thought her crazy family were behaving normally, her parents make an announcement that could turn everything upside down. If only Zoran, their au pair, would come back to live with them. Unfortunately he's too busy teaching guitar to his new protege, Zachary Smith.

The diary of Bluebell Gadsby is original, hilarious and a un-putdown-able read. From page one you melt straight in and feel as though you are Bluebell. The Gadsby family is made up of strong, vivid characters that have the perfect quantity of problems to make it fun and exciting. Natasha Farrant has created one of those families we dream we were born into. What's more, her style stands out as she cleverly and creatively uses script and diary format throughout the novel. I recommend this for ages 10 and up. Guardian
